Бесплатные курсы по разработке игр
- Популярные
- Высокий рейтинг
Лучшие бесплатные курсы по разработке игр
Суть профессии
Разработчик игр — это программист, который занимается созданием и налаживанием виртуального игрового мира. Профессия требует творческого мышления, а также технических знаний и навыков.
Разработка компьютерных игр — широкая индустрия. Она включает в себя такие специальности, как:
-
Gameplay developer — разрабатывает общую идею игры
-
Animation developer — разрабатывает визуальную основу
-
Engine developer — разрабатывает утилиты и поддерживает интеграцию со сторонними приложениями
-
DevOps developer — автоматизируют сборку и отвечают за эксплуатацию системы
-
UI и Client developers — отвечают за удобство системы в интерфейсе
-
Graphics programmer — минимизирует требования при установке игры на устройства
-
Back-end developer — отвечает за работоспособность продукта
-
Тестировщик — проверяет работоспособность программы
-
Сценарист — придумывает сюжеты
Выбор направления для изучения зависит от предпочтений, способностей и склонностей ученика.
Кому подойдут курсы
Зачастую бесплатные онлайн-курсы раскрывают общую теорию по разработке игр или обучают по одному из направлений в digital-сфере. Часто обучение рассчитано на новичков, которые хотят примерить на себя роль разработчика и понять, подходит ли им эта профессия.
Уже работающим специалистам тоже будет полезно пройти курс. Повторение теории и отработка задач позволят восполнить пробелы в памяти или усвоить новый материал, который ранее был не изучен.
Чему научат на курсах
Бесплатные курсы по разработке игр представляют собой введение в профессию. Занятия проходят онлайн в формате видеоуроков. После теории ученикам дают домашнее задание. Так, обучающие платформы и школы предоставляют набор базовых знаний и ориентиров.
Уроки могут включать такие темы, как:
-
История развития игровой индустрии
-
Разбор профессий и выбор специализации
-
Написание простых игровых схем
-
Способы создания видеоигр
-
Разбор инструментов
Каждый автор курса разрабатывает собственную программу. Преподаватели могут углубиться в одну из тем в зависимости от конкретной специализации.
Плюсы и минусы
Онлайн-курсы имеют свои преимущества и недостатки. В качестве плюсов выделяют такие, как:
-
Возможность обучения из любой точки мира без привязке к конкретной дате и времени
-
Возможность прекратить учебу без страха потерять деньги
-
Информация предоставляется в доступном формате, на понятном новичку языке
В качестве минусов выделяют:
-
Навыки и личные характеристики учеников не учитываются. Программа курса может оказаться слишком легкой или, наоборот, сложной для студента
-
Домашние задания никто не проверяет, обратной связи от педагога нет
-
Бесплатная учеба дает поверхностную теорию без детального углубления в темы
Чтобы объективно оценить качество программы и подобрать подходящую, можно сравнить несколько онлайн-школ, ознакомиться с отзывами других учеников.
Ответы на вопросы
Отметим, что каждый когда-то начинал с нуля. Чтобы достичь мастерства нужно упорно учиться и практиковаться. В профессии разработчика существуют следующие ступени профессионализма:
-
Стажер — помощник профессионала
-
Junior — новичок в профессии
-
Middle — средняя ступень в карьерной лестнице. Специалист работал не менее 1 года и может брать ответственность за свои действия без дополнительных проверок
-
Senior — профессионал, который выполняет задачи любой сложности. Он принимает самостоятельные решения в процессе разработки
Карьерный рост возможен лишь тогда, когда профессия человеку интересна. Чтобы расти как специалист нужно постоянно повышать сложность рабочих проектов.
Новичок в профессии может претендовать на заработную плату в пределах 70 000 рублей. Профессионал получает от 170 000 рублей. При этом потолок возможного заработка отсутствует. Разработчик может работать как на компанию в офисе, так и на фрилансе, выбирая только интересные для себя проекты.
ТОП- 9 лучших бесплатных курсов по разработке игр
1. Курс Введение в игровую индустрию от Skillbox
Вы разберётесь, какие специальности есть в геймдеве, на что может рассчитывать новичок на старте, и поймёте, чем хотите заниматься именно вы. Познакомитесь с полным циклом производства игр: от хай‑концепта до издания.
Школа | Skillbox |
Длительность | 1 месяц |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Свободный график |
Тип обучения | Курс |
Доступ после прохождения | Есть |
2. Курс Создаём первую игру на Unity от Нетология
Вы познакомитесь с самым популярным движком для создания онлайн-игр, с нуля создадите прототип игры, сделаете первый шаг в разработке игр
Школа | Нетология |
Длительность | 3 дня |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Свободный график |
Тип обучения | Курс |
Доступ после прохождения | Есть |
Инструменты | Unity |
Проекты в портфолио | С нуля создадите прототип игры в жанре shooter |
3. Курс Программирование игр: ознакомительный курс для новичков от Coddyschool
Познакомитесь с разными платформами и средами программирования, освоите азы создания игр в каждой из них. Выберете наиболее интересное и подходящее по уровню знаний направление, чтобы изучать его подробнее на углубленных курсах.
Школа | Coddyschool |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Есть расписание |
Тип обучения | Курс |
Доступ после прохождения | Нет |
Инструменты | Scratch, Unity 3D, Python |
Проекты в портфолио | Создание первого проекта |
4. Курс Создание игр в Roblox с Шоном от Coddyschool
Бесплатные уроки от нашего ученика Шона, который отлично освоил программирование в Roblox и готов поделиться своими знаниями
Школа | Coddyschool |
Длительность | 8 уроков |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Есть расписание |
Тип обучения | Курс |
Доступ после прохождения | Нет |
Инструменты | Roblox Studio |
Проекты в портфолио | Создание «Шоколадной фабрики». Создание ракеты и неба. Создание игроков. Строительство кинотеатра. Создание игры с мячом |
5. Курс Разработчик игр на Unity с нуля от Skillbox
Вы с нуля освоите игровую разработку: научитесь писать на С#, создавать игры на Unity и писать свои дополнения для движка. Сможете создать игру, о которой всегда мечтали, или устроиться разработчиком в крутую студию.
Школа | Skillbox |
Длительность | 7 уроков |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Свободный график |
Тип обучения | Курс |
Доступ после прохождения | Есть |
Инструменты | С#, Unity |
6. Курс Введение в игровую индустрию от Skillbox
Вы разберётесь, какие специальности есть в геймдеве, на что может рассчитывать новичок на старте, и поймёте, чем хотите заниматься именно вы. Познакомитесь с полным циклом производства игр: от хай‑концепта до издания.
Школа | Skillbox |
Длительность | 10 уроков |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Свободный график |
Тип обучения | Курс |
Доступ после прохождения | Есть |
Инструменты | Unity, Unreal Engine 4 |
7. Курс Unreal Engine 4 от Skillbox
Вместе с опытным разработчиком Павлом Горкиным вы научитесь работать с игровым движком Unreal Engine 4, поработаете над персонажем, игровым окружением и создадите свою первую видеоигру.
Школа | Skillbox |
Длительность | 9 уроков |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Свободный график |
Тип обучения | Курс |
Доступ после прохождения | Есть |
Инструменты | Unreal Engine 4 |
Проекты в портфолио | Создадите видеоигру\ |
8. Курс Unity от Skillbox
Изучите игровой движок, на котором работают Genshin Impact, Rust, Escape from Tarkov, Call of Duty: Mobile. Разработчики из российских и зарубежных студий помогут вам создать первые игры для портфолио. Вы узнаете, из каких этапов состоит работа над проектом, научитесь добавлять графику, персонажей и оживлять сцены.
Школа | Skillbox |
Длительность | 21 урок |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Свободный график |
Тип обучения | Курс |
Доступ после прохождения | Есть |
Инструменты | Unity |
Проекты в портфолио | Создадите первую игру |
9. Курс Intro Hyper Casual от XYZ School
Создай мобильную игру с нуля за 72 часа
Школа | XYZ School |
Длительность | 1 неделя |
Стоимость | Бесплатно |
Помощь в трудоустройстве | Нет |
Документ об окончании | Нет |
График прохождения | Свободный график |
Тип обучения | Курс |
Доступ после прохождения | Есть |
Инструменты | Bolt, Unity |
Проекты в портфолио | Создадите первую гиперказуальную игру без кода |
Курсы программирования
- Android-разработчик
- 1С-Битрикс
- 1С-разработчик
- Ansible
- ASP.NET
- Azure
- Backend
- C#
- C++
- CI/CD
- Dart
- DevOps
- Docker
- Frontend
- Fullstack
- Golang
- HiberNate
- HTML и CSS
- iOS-разработчик
- Java
- JavaScript
- JUnit
- Kotlin
- Kubernetes
- MySQL
- No-Code разработка
- PHP
- PostgreSQL
- Python
- QA-тестирование
- ReactJS
- Ruby
- Scala
- SQL
- Swift
- Symfony
- TypeScript
- Unity
- Unreal Engine
- VBA Excel
- VR/AR
- Vue.js
- Автоматизация тестирования
- Алгоритмы
- Базы данных
- Веб-разработка
- Инженер автоматизации
- Мобильная разработка
- Паскаль
- Программирования дронов
- Работа с GIT
- Разработка игр
- Робототехника
- Ручное тестирование ПО
- Создание сайтов
- Тестирование игр
- Технический писатель
- Фреймворк Django
- Фреймворк Flutter
- Фреймворк Laravel
- Фреймворк Node.js
- Фреймворк Spring
- Языки программирования
- Курсы IT
- Wordpress
- ООП
- Angular
- Bootstrap
- Реверс инжиниринг
- Rust
- Oracle SQL
- Microsoft SQL
- Микросервисная архитектура
- REST
- XML
- Redux
- Python тестировщик